Have You Heard the Jordanian Version of 'Rockstar'?

By H.A.R. on Oct 31, 2008

I just got an e-mail from a friend with an MP3 attachment ... she tells me that it's a contagious song.
The song is entitled 'Suberstar' and it's the Jordanian version of Nickleback's hit 'Rockstar'.
If you're Jordanian you'll really dig the song, but if you're not you'll surely enjoy it just the same because it's just plain funny! (that's if you speak Arabic of course) Listen to 'Suberstar'.
The guys who came up with this cool idea are two Jordanian dudes called Humam Ammari and Nadim Masri.

Those two aren't singers or anything, they just did it and sent it out to some of their friends, next thing they know it's all over the place and people from outisde Jordan are asking them about 'Suberstar'! Talk about viral marketing at it's best!
Now that the song is a success, they do plan on shooting a silly music video and will be posting it on YouTube ... more viral marketing, dare i say!

For all you guys who don't speak Arabic and would like to know what the lyrics are saying, my friend Roba over at And Far Away translated the song and it's still as catchy!
